ART’S-WAY ANNOUNCES A 139% INCREASE IN NET INCOME
FOR THE FISCAL YEAR 2007

ARMSTRONG, IOWA, February 19, 2008 - Art’s-Way Manufacturing Co., Inc., (NASDAQ:ARTW) a leading manufacturer and distributor of agricultural machinery, equipment and services announces its financial results for the fiscal year ended November 30, 2007.

Highlights:
·  
Net sales increased $5,663,938 compared to the same period a year ago.
·  
Year to date earnings per share are up $.66 over 2006.
·  
As of February 2008, order backlog has increased to $15,406,000 compared to $11,792,000 in February 2007.

Revenue: Total revenue increased 29%, from $19.85 million to $25.52 million for the fiscal year ended November 30, 2007. A large portion of the increase is due to the full year of Art’s-Way Scientific revenues, versus only four months of revenue included in the same period ended November 30, 2006.

Income: Operating income increased from $1.77 million to $3.76 million for the fiscal year ended November 30, 2007, while net income for the fiscal year ended November 30, 2007 increased 139%, from $0.93 million to $2.23 million. These increases are due to an increase in sales and gross margin while holding the costs of operations, sales, and administration down.

EBITDA: EBITDA (Ear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ation, and amortization) increased 93% to $4.1 million for the fiscal year ended November 30, 2007, versus $2.1 million for the fiscal year ended November 30, 2006.

Earnings per Share: Earnings per diluted and basic share increased $.66 for the year ended November 30, 2007 to $1.13, which is a 140% increase over the earnings per share for the fiscal year ended November 30, 2006.

About Art’s-Way Manufacturing Co., Inc. (ARTW)
Art’s-Way manufactures and distributes farm machinery niche products including animal feed processing equipment, sugar beet defoliators and harvesters, land maintenance equipment, crop shredding equipment, plows, hay and forage equipment. After market service parts are also an important part of the Company’s business. We have two wholly owned subsidiaries, Art’s-Way Vessels, Inc. manufactures pressurized tanks and vessels and Art’s-Way Scientific, Inc. manufactures modular animal confinement buildings and modular laboratories.
